Your server does not support PHP mail() function ? don’t worry :) Vision Helpdesk allows you to choose alternate SMTP server to send email reply’s to your clients.

SMTP Authentication Support

SMTP Authentication Support

By default Vision Helpdesk uses PHP mail() function to send email reply to client tickets, for some reason you want alternate method to send outgoing emails then you can setup SMTP settings in Admin >> Preferences >> SMTP

This  SMTP setting allows  Vision Helpdesk to bypass the PHP mail() function and send email directly to an SMTP server. The module supports SMTP authentication and can even connect to servers using SSL if supported by PHP.
